Sanitizing with Vinegar or Bleach Solutions
When it comes to sanitizing chicken eggs for hatching, many breeders consider using vinegar or bleach solutions. Both options have their benefits and risks, which we’ll explore below.
Vinegar solutions are a popular choice among backyard chicken keepers due to their gentleness on eggshells and the environment. A 1:3 ratio of white vinegar to water is a common dilution for sanitizing eggs. However, be cautious not to leave the eggs in the solution for too long, as excessive acidity can harm the embryo.
Bleach solutions are more potent but require careful handling to avoid damage to the eggshell. A 1:10 ratio of unscented bleach to water is recommended. Never use scented bleach or mix it with other cleaning products, as this can lead to unpredictable results. Always rinse the eggs thoroughly after sanitizing with a bleach solution to remove any residue.
Remember, over-saturation and improper handling can negate the benefits of sanitizing solutions altogether. Always follow proper safety precautions when working with these chemicals, including wearing gloves and ensuring good ventilation.

Maintaining a Consistent Temperature and Humidity Level
Maintaining a consistent temperature and humidity level is crucial during the incubation period. This ensures that the eggs develop normally and increase the chances of successful hatching. Temperature fluctuations can cause stress to the embryo, leading to developmental issues or even death.
The ideal temperature range for most chicken breeds is between 99°F and 100°F (37°C to 38°C) during the first 18 days of incubation, followed by a slight drop to around 98°F (36.7°C) on day 18 and beyond. Humidity levels should be maintained at approximately 50-60% during the first week and then gradually reduced to around 30-40% for the remaining period.
To achieve this stable environment, you can use an incubation cabinet or a homemade setup with a heat source and a humidifier. It’s essential to monitor temperature and humidity levels regularly using thermometers and hygrometers. Make adjustments as needed to maintain optimal conditions. By providing a consistent temperature and humidity level, you’ll create a healthy environment for your eggs to develop and hatch successfully.

Identifying Contamination Symptoms
When dealing with contaminated eggs, it’s essential to identify symptoms promptly to prevent further damage. One common indicator is mold growth on the eggshell. Check for a fuzzy white or greenish-gray appearance, especially around the air cell at the large end of the egg. If you notice any mold, carefully discard the affected egg as it can’t be salvaged.
Another sign of contamination is an unusual odor emanating from the egg. Be cautious if you smell a pungent, sour, or ammonia-like scent coming from an egg. This could indicate bacterial growth, and it’s crucial to remove the egg from your incubation project.
To assess whether eggs are contaminated, gently candle them (use a flashlight or lamp to illuminate through the egg) and look for any visible signs of development. Check for blood spots, feathers, or other internal abnormalities. If you’re still unsure about an egg’s integrity, it’s better to err on the side of caution and discard it.
